Land Development Project Manager salary in Morocco

Average Yearly Salary of Land Development Project Manager in Morocco is approximately 258,868 MAD (23,469 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. What does Land Development Project Manager do?

occupation personasA land development project manager is responsible for overseeing and coordinating the development of land for various purposes such as residential, commercial, or industrial projects. They work closely with architects, engineers, contractors, and government officials to ensure that the project is planned, designed, and executed effectively and efficiently. The role of a land development project manager involves tasks such as conducting feasibility studies, managing budgets and timelines, obtaining necessary permits and approvals, coordinating with stakeholders, and ensuring compliance with regulations and environmental standards. They also manage the procurement of materials and services, supervise construction activities, and monitor progress to ensure that the project is completed on time and within budget.
